本文目录导读:
随着互联网的飞速发展,旅游行业逐渐成为人们关注的焦点,众多企业纷纷投身于旅游网站的开发与运营,而ThinkPHP作为一款优秀的开源PHP框架,凭借其高效、易用、可扩展的特性,成为众多开发者的首选,本文将针对ThinkPHP旅游网站源码进行深入剖析,为广大开发者提供高效开发之道。
ThinkPHP旅游网站源码概述
ThinkPHP旅游网站源码是一款基于ThinkPHP框架开发的旅游类网站,具备完善的旅游产品展示、在线预订、用户评论、旅游资讯等功能,源码结构清晰,代码规范,便于开发者学习和二次开发。
ThinkPHP旅游网站源码核心模块解析
1、前端模块
前端模块主要采用HTML、CSS、JavaScript等技术,负责展示旅游产品、用户评论、旅游资讯等页面内容,在ThinkPHP框架中,前端模块通常通过模板引擎进行渲染,以下是前端模块的主要功能:
图片来源于网络,如有侵权联系删除
(1)首页:展示热门旅游产品、最新旅游资讯、热门目的地等信息;
(2)产品详情页:展示旅游产品的详细信息,包括行程安排、价格、图片等;
(3)预订页面:实现用户在线预订旅游产品;
(4)评论页面:展示用户对旅游产品的评价;
(5)资讯页面:展示旅游行业最新资讯。
2、后端模块
后端模块主要负责处理业务逻辑、数据存储、接口调用等功能,以下是后端模块的主要功能:
(1)产品管理:实现旅游产品的增删改查操作;
图片来源于网络,如有侵权联系删除
(2)订单管理:处理用户订单的创建、修改、取消等操作;
(3)评论管理:对用户评论进行审核、删除等操作;
(4)资讯管理:实现旅游资讯的增删改查操作;
(5)用户管理:实现用户注册、登录、信息修改等功能。
3、数据库模块
数据库模块负责存储网站数据,包括旅游产品、订单、评论、资讯、用户等信息,在ThinkPHP框架中,数据库模块通常采用MySQL数据库,以下是数据库模块的主要功能:
(1)数据存储:将网站数据存储到MySQL数据库中;
(2)数据查询:根据用户需求查询数据库中的数据;
图片来源于网络,如有侵权联系删除
(3)数据更新:对数据库中的数据进行修改、删除等操作。
ThinkPHP旅游网站源码开发技巧
1、规范代码:遵循ThinkPHP框架的编码规范,提高代码可读性和可维护性;
2、优化性能:合理使用缓存、索引等技术,提高网站性能;
3、安全防护:对用户输入进行验证,防止SQL注入、XSS攻击等安全风险;
4、模块化开发:将网站功能模块化,便于后期维护和扩展;
5、组件化开发:利用ThinkPHP框架提供的组件,提高开发效率。
ThinkPHP旅游网站源码是一款功能完善、易于开发的旅游类网站,通过对源码的深入剖析,我们了解到ThinkPHP框架在旅游网站开发中的应用,掌握ThinkPHP开发技巧,将有助于开发者提高开发效率,打造出更多优质的旅游网站。
标签: #thinkphp旅游网站源码
评论列表